Understanding Cloud Computing
At its core, cloud computing refers to the delivery of various services—such as storage, processing power, and software—over the internet (‘the cloud’). This model allows users to access and manage their data and applications remotely rather than relying on localized servers or personal devices. The cloud is built upon a network of remote servers hosted on the internet, offering immense flexibility and scalability.
The Benefits of Cloud Technology
Cloud computing brings a plethora of advantages to the table, making it a preferred choice for businesses of all sizes:
- Cost Efficiency: Traditional IT infrastructure requires significant upfront investment. The cloud operates on a pay-as-you-go model, allowing companies to only pay for the resources they use.
- Scalability: Businesses can easily scale their IT resources up or down depending on demand, ensuring they are not overpaying for unused capacity.
- Accessibility: With cloud computing, users can access their data and applications from anywhere with an internet connection, fostering remote work and collaboration.
- Disaster Recovery: Cloud services often include built-in backup and recovery solutions, helping organizations to safeguard their data against loss due to unforeseen events.
- Automatic Updates: Cloud providers manage updates and maintenance, freeing businesses from the burden of manual software upgrades and ensuring they always have access to the latest features.
Types of Cloud Services
Cloud computing is not a one-size-fits-all solution. Different types of cloud services cater to varying needs:
- Infrastructure as a Service (IaaS): This service provides virtualized computing resources over the internet. Companies can rent servers, storage, and networking on a pay-per-use basis, allowing them to run applications without investing in physical infrastructure.
- Platform as a Service (PaaS): PaaS offers a platform allowing developers to build, deploy, and manage applications without worrying about the underlying infrastructure. It streamlines the development process and supports collaboration among teams.
- Software as a Service (SaaS): SaaS delivers software applications over the internet on a subscription basis. Users can access applications directly through a web browser without needing to install or maintain them locally.
Cloud Deployment Models
The cloud can be deployed in several different models, each with its distinct advantages and use cases:
- Public Cloud: In a public cloud environment, services and infrastructure are provided by third-party vendors over the public internet. This model is typically cost-effective and scalable, making it suitable for many companies.
- Private Cloud: A private cloud is dedicated to a single organization and can be hosted on-site or by a third party. This model offers enhanced security and control, appealing to businesses with strict regulatory requirements.
- Hybrid Cloud: Combining elements of both public and private clouds, hybrid clouds allow organizations to enjoy the benefits of both environments. This model offers flexibility and enables businesses to maintain sensitive data in a private cloud while leveraging the public cloud for less critical operations.
Transforming Industries with the Cloud
The impact of cloud technology extends across numerous industries, revolutionizing how they operate and deliver services:
Healthcare
In healthcare, cloud computing facilitates the storage and sharing of patient records, enabling seamless collaboration among medical professionals. Telemedicine platforms leverage the cloud to provide remote consultations, improving access to care while reducing costs.
Finance
The financial sector utilizes the cloud for analytics and real-time data processing, enhancing decision-making and risk management. Cloud-based solutions also support regulatory compliance by providing secure and efficient data storage.
Retail
Retailers benefit from cloud technology by utilizing data analytics to understand customer behavior and preferences. Cloud-based inventory management systems enable real-time tracking and forecasting, improving operational efficiency and customer satisfaction.

The Future of Cloud Computing
As technology continues to advance, the future of cloud computing looks promising. Emerging trends such as edge computing, artificial intelligence (AI), and machine learning are set to enhance cloud capabilities further. Edge computing allows data processing to occur closer to the source, reducing latency and improving response times. Integrating AI with cloud services can lead to smarter analytics, automating routine tasks and uncovering actionable insights.
